If its a DX drop in, make sure you don't tighten the brass pill all the way down into the reflector. Doing so will leave a loose fit between the pill and body and an intermittent contact will result.

Its just a spring connected to a metal plate. Use a multi meter and check for continuity between the "-" spring and pressure plate. Clean the contact points with isopropyl alcohol and a Q-tip.
 
If it is a Surefire twisty tail cap, the chances are higher that the problem is with your drop in as the tail caps are very reliable.

Does the drop in work when you make the connection between the -ve battery terminal and the bottom of the tail cap (ie with a paper clip)?
